The MoveMeant Project provides a full and enriching curriculum of dance classes, designed to accommodate a wide array of ages, skill levels, and artistic aspirations. Their diverse offerings ensure that every student can find their rhythm and grow within a supportive, professional environment.
- Ballet: Foundational training in classical ballet technique, emphasizing grace, strength, posture, and discipline.
- Jazz: Energetic and dynamic classes focusing on rhythm, turns, leaps, and contemporary jazz styles.
- Lyrical: Blending elements of ballet and jazz, lyrical dance emphasizes emotional expression and storytelling through fluid movement.
- Tap: Classes focused on rhythmic footwork, musicality, and coordination, covering various tap styles.
- Musical Theatre: Integrating dance with acting and singing, these classes prepare students for stage performance in Broadway-style productions.
- Hip Hop: High-energy classes exploring diverse urban dance forms, freestyle, and choreographed routines.
- Classes for Young Children: Special emphasis is designed to introduce young children to various dance forms in an engaging and age-appropriate manner, fostering an early love for movement.
